The actual work is in LiveExec32, a separate repo under the LiveContainer org. It takes ARMv7 binaries and runs them on 64-bit iOS by passing syscalls through to the host.

Apple dropped 32-bit apps in iOS 11 in 2017.

Free Apple accounts are limited to 3 active sideloaded apps.

One common workaround is LiveContainer, which allows you to run additional apps inside a container and reduce how often apps need to be reinstalled.

Typical method:

  • Sideload GetMoreRam
  • Use it to apply the increased memory entitlement to LiveContainer
  • Uninstall GetMoreRam to avoid hitting the 3 app limit
  • Then sideload StikDebug for JIT activation

LiveContainer may also need to be uninstalled and reinstalled before the entitlement works correctly.

LiveContainer can also install two additional LiveContainers (for a total of three). This setup can further reduce the need to constantly add/remove sideloaded apps, but it is more advanced and may not work reliably for everyone.

LiveContainer is not always officially supported by emulator developers and can sometimes cause unexpected issues. If something breaks while using LiveContainer, try reproducing the issue without it before asking for support.
